Gallery Baton will participate in Taipei Dangdai 2024, hosted by UBS, with leading domestic and international artists.
The art fair is an important link between East Asian contemporary art and lasts for four days, providing a meeting place for local and international collectors to explore the art market.
Taipei Dangdai is part of The Art Assembly, which focuses on the Asia-Pacific region consisting of ARTSG and Tokyo Gendai.
The fair, which will be held in 2024, will feature a new category, Evoke, with programs focusing on solo presentations or juxtapositions of established artists.
The event welcomes collectors, art lovers, and the general public, and will feature selected programs such as lectures, workshops, pop-up restaurants, cafes, and bars.
In addition, for the first time, 'Before Thunder: An Exhibition of Taiwanese Artists', a special exhibition co-hosted by the Ministry of Culture, will be held at the fair.
The event will be open to the public from the 10th to the 12th, starting with a VIP preview on the 9th at the Taipei Nangang Exhibition Center.
